Potassium ion (K⁺) is a monoatomic cation derived from the element potassium. It is the major intracellular cation in animal cells and plays essential roles in numerous physiological processes, including maintaining membrane potential, generating action potentials, regulating water balance, and supporting muscle contraction and nerve function. It is used therapeutically to treat or prevent hypokalemia (low potassium levels), which can result from various medical conditions or treatments. Potassium ions move passively through specific pores or channels in cell membranes. These include Ion Channels and Ion Pumps. Potassium channels are tetrameric proteins forming a central pore selective for K⁺.
Passive diffusion via ion channels; active transport via pumps
